Topic: I am curious, anyone with hunger pangs?
I had my surgery 1/6, and to date I have not had any hunger pangs! While this is wonderful for me ( I was hungry all the time before surgery and even if I had a large meal, I would be hungry and ready to eat again in 2 hours or so). I have had "head hunger" or smell something cooking and think 'oh, I want some of that' but not real hunger, or where my stomach was growling. I eat at normal meal times, because everyone tells me to eat 3 meals a day, and have protein drinks to get all the protein in, but hunger in terms of rumbling in my stomach, not at all. I am not complaining, but a few others I have spoken with think it is odd that I don't get hungry. Are there other non hungry people out there? Just curious! Sarah

Topic: RE: Lets compare
Well Alberto, I had my surgery on 1/21 so I am a little more than 5 months out now and as of today I am down 85 pounds. I was hoping to be down 100 by my 6month anniversary but looks like it will be closer to 90. In any event I feel so much better than I did before, I am working out at curves 3x week, I even went out dancing with friends 2 weeks ago and surpised myself by being able to dance for mor than 30 minutes without dying. Hardly could dance one fast one pre-surgery without sweating. So now Iam sure that it will start slowing down but it will come off, I would like to get down to 140 so I am 35 pounds away from my goal and for once in my life I will have a BMI that is in the normal weight range Yeah!
